In short, the Madhya Pradesh League is a franchise-based T20 cricket league organized by the Gwalior Division Cricket Association (GDCA) under the Madhya Pradesh Cricket Association (MPCA). Additionally, the league carries official approval from the BCCI, which makes it Madhya Pradesh’s only sanctioned franchise T20 tournament.

Madhya Pradesh League (MPL) T20 2026
Source – ANI

To begin with, the league launched its inaugural edition in 2024 with just five men’s teams at the MPCA International Cricket Stadium in Gwalior. In that first season, Jabalpur Lions claimed the maiden title by beating Bhopal Leopards by 33 runs in the final.

Subsequently, the league expanded to seven men’s teams in 2025 while also moving to a longer round-robin format. Most notably, Bhopal Leopards clinched that title in a last-ball thriller by defending just 156 against Chambal Ghariyals to win by three runs

For 2026, however, the tournament takes another massive leap with 10 men’s franchises and 5 women’s teams. Furthermore, the venue shifts to the iconic Holkar Stadium in Indore, which boasts a seating capacity of 30,000. Women’s Teams in MPL 2026

Similarly, women’s cricket also gets a bigger stage in the MPL ecosystem this year. In fact, the competition has grown from three teams in 2025 to five franchises, so more female cricketers across Madhya Pradesh get a chance to showcase their talent. Specifically, Gwalior Shernis and Royal Nimar Eagles join returning sides Bhopal Wolves, Bundelkhand Bulls, and Chambal Ghariyals for the expanded women’s tournament.

Notably, the women’s tournament begins on June 4 at Daly College in Indore, with Chambal Ghariyals facing Gwalior Shernis in the opener at 10:00 AM IST.

Venue: Holkar Stadium, Indore

In a significant change from previous editions, the men’s matches move to the Holkar Stadium in Indore this year. By contrast, the previous two seasons took place at the Shrimant Madhavrao Scindia Cricket Stadium in Gwalior. As a result, fans in Indore get home-ground MPL action for the first time ever.

Specifically, the Holkar Cricket Stadium sits on Race Course Road in Indore and holds 30,000 spectators. Besides hosting international Tests, ODIs, and T20Is for the India national team, the ground also consistently produces batting-friendly surfaces. Therefore, you should expect high-scoring thrillers throughout the tournament. In addition, the stadium’s excellent floodlights make it ideal for the evening double-header format.

For context, the 2024 inaugural season aired on JioCinema. Then, starting from 2025, FanCode took over the streaming rights and continues as the broadcast partner for 2026.
